USB: musb: dereferencing an iomem pointer
"tx_ram" points to io memory. We can't dereference it directly. Sparse complains about this: "drivers/usb/musb/cppi_dma.c:1205:25: warning: dereference of noderef expression" Signed-off-by: Dan Carpenter <error27@gmail.com> Signed-off-by: Felipe Balbi <balbi@ti.com>
This commit is contained in:
committed by
Felipe Balbi
parent
2fbcf3fa43
commit
2e10f5e70f
@@ -1204,7 +1204,7 @@ irqreturn_t cppi_interrupt(int irq, void *dev_id)
|
|||||||
*/
|
*/
|
||||||
if (NULL == bd) {
|
if (NULL == bd) {
|
||||||
DBG(1, "null BD\n");
|
DBG(1, "null BD\n");
|
||||||
tx_ram->tx_complete = 0;
|
musb_writel(&tx_ram->tx_complete, 0, 0);
|
||||||
continue;
|
continue;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user